Здесь показаны различия между двумя версиями данной страницы.
| Предыдущая версия справа и слева Предыдущая версия Следующая версия | Предыдущая версия | ||
|
logbook_chat_auth [2018/12/12 15:37] kevin |
logbook_chat_auth [2019/10/15 08:39] (текущий) |
||
|---|---|---|---|
| Строка 3: | Строка 3: | ||
| ---- | ---- | ||
| - | Для авторизации в чате (мессенджере) используется метод "cmd"="auth" | + | ====== Авторизация ====== |
| + | |||
| + | Для авторизации в чате (мессенджере) | ||
| + | |||
| + | Параметры: | ||
| + | * **cmd - "auth" ** | ||
| + | * **login** - логин | ||
| + | * **password** - пароль | ||
| Пример: | Пример: | ||
| Запрос: | Запрос: | ||
| - | <code> | + | { |
| - | {"cmd":"auth","login":"test","password":"123"} | + | "cmd":"auth", |
| - | </code> | + | "login":"test", |
| + | "password":"123" | ||
| + | } | ||
| - | При успешном ответе поле "error" будет пустым, при этом возвращается токен, который должен присутствовать во всех последующих запросах. | + | При успешном ответе поле "error" будет пустым, при этом возвращается токен соединения, возможно понадобится в будущем. |
| Успешный ответ: | Успешный ответ: | ||
| - | <code> | + | { |
| - | {"error":"","token":"XXXXXXXXXXXXXXXX"} | + | "error":"", |
| - | </code> | + | "cmd":"auth", |
| + | "obj": { | ||
| + | "token":"XXXXXXXXXXXXXXXX" | ||
| + | } | ||
| + | } | ||
| Ошибка (перечень всех возможных ошибок можно увидеть [[logBook/chat/errors|тут]]): | Ошибка (перечень всех возможных ошибок можно увидеть [[logBook/chat/errors|тут]]): | ||
| - | <code> | ||
| - | {"error":"AUTH_FAIL","description":"Wrong login or password"} | ||
| - | </code> | ||
| + | { | ||
| + | "error":"AUTH_FAIL&&Wrong login or password", | ||
| + | "cmd":"auth", | ||
| + | "obj": {} | ||
| + | } | ||